Subject: DR drill next Thursday — parcel-tracking webhook. Hi, and welcome to the Ferngate logistics team. Next Thursday we run our quarterly disaster-recovery drill for the Swiftroute parcel-tracking webhook. We will simulate a full region failure and verify the webhook replays undelivered events from the standby queue. As a new contractor, your role is observation only, but you will need access to the drill dashboard. If your drill account locks during the exercise, use the recovery passphrase provided below.

strongbox words: wenion-olimir-quenion-tamius

**Q: How do I get keys for the pool cars?**

Pool car keys for the Larkfield office are kept in the wall cabinet beside the mailroom. Team assistants should book a vehicle in the fleet calendar first, then sign the key out on the clipboard. Return keys by 17:30. The cabinet opens with the code below.

staff pass of kagef-yahip = bdg-TKELFT-63915354

## Service Accounts: Breakerline

The Breakerline circuit breaker guards all calls from our order pipeline to the upstream Quotanix pricing API. When Quotanix error rates exceed the threshold, Breakerline opens and serves cached quotes for five minutes. As a contractor you'll mostly interact with its status endpoint, which reports breaker state and trip history. Status queries run under the shared service account rather than your personal login. That account authenticates to Breakerline's admin plane with the internal key shown below.

app token of bawep-hafog = kto7_vwrmnlx

**Q: How is Brindlekit versioned?**

Brindlekit follows strict semver. Breaking prop changes bump the major; new components bump the minor. Each release is tagged and signed, and the publish pipeline refuses unsigned tags. Consumers pin to a major range and upgrade quarterly. If the signing keystore is locked out after three failed attempts, restore access using the recovery passphrase kept on the line just below.

strongbox words: zorwyn-sorael-belion-ulaius-silmir-ulays-briax-rusdor-gorix